About 3rd Grade English Language Support Multiplication Fact Fluency Resources
On Education.com, parents and teachers can find 3rd Grade English Language Support multiplication fact fluency resources that include printable worksheets, interactive games, and practice exercises. These materials help young learners strengthen their understanding of multiplication strategies, improve number fluency, and develop confidence with math operations. Educators and caregivers can access resources tailored to support students working on multiplication as part of the grade 3 curriculum. The site offers punch card practice sheets, skip counting activities, and timed drills to reinforce mastering multiplication facts.
Additionally, Education.com provides a variety of printable flashcards, number charts, and situational word problems designed to help students connect multiplication facts to real-world contexts. These resources give learners multiple ways to practice and apply their skills, from structured drills to engaging practice games. Each worksheet or activity is designed to make learning multiplicationfact fluency engaging and accessible, catering to different learning styles and paces.
For parents and teachers, these multiplication fact practice resources offer ready-to-use materials that support consistent practice and reinforce the foundation of arithmetic. Using these tools can help students build speed, accuracy, and confidence in their math skills while providing structured lessons that fit into classroom or at-home learning plans.
